										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ultra-compact high pressure pump</p>
<p>AZURA P 2.1S and P 4.1S pump are developed for eluent delivery up to 400 bar and for flow rates up to 10 ml/min in HPLC and other applications where a compact easy-to-integrate pump is required.</p>

Operating temperature: Between -40 °C and +200 °C.">FKM</span>, <span title="PEEK is a durable and resistant plastic and, apart from stainless steel, the standard material in HPLC. It can be used at temperatures up to 100 °C and is highly chemical resistant against almost all commonly used solvents in a pH range of 1-12, 5. PEEK is potentially moderate resistant against oxidizing and reducing solvents. Therefore, following solvents should not be used: Concentrated and oxidizing acids (such as nitric acid solution, sulfuric acid), halogenated acids (such as hydrofluoric acid, hydrobromic acid) and gaseous halogens. Hydrochloric acid is approved for most applications. In addition, following solvents can have a swelling effect and may have an impact on the functionality of the built-in components: Methylene chloride, THF and DMSO in any concentration such as acetonitrile in higher concentrations. ">PEEK</span>, <span title="Synthetic sapphire is virtually pure monocrystalline aluminium oxide. It is biocompatible and very resistant to corrosion and wear. 										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ultra-compact high pressure pump</p>
<p>The AZURA pump P 4.1S (APG20EB) is developed for the eluent delivery with flow rates up to 10 ml/min and a maximum delivere pressure of 350 bar. This compact pump can easily be integrated into every HPLC system. It can be used as a small HPLC pump, an injection module or dosing pump. This device variant is the bio-inert version with a pump head made of ceramic.</p>
